About 4-N,9-N-bis[(2E,4Z)-hexa-2,4-dien-3-yl]-4-N,9-N,6,7-tetraphenyl-[1,2,5]thiadiazolo[3,4-g]quinoxaline-4,9-diamine

4-N,9-N-bis[(2E,4Z)-hexa-2,4-dien-3-yl]-4-N,9-N,6,7-tetraphenyl-[1,2,5]thiadiazolo[3,4-g]quinoxaline-4,9-diamine (PubChem CID 134185766) has the molecular formula C44H38N6S and a molecular weight of 682.90 g/mol. Its IUPAC name is 4-N,9-N-bis[(2E,4Z)-hexa-2,4-dien-3-yl]-4-N,9-N,6,7-tetraphenyl-[1,2,5]thiadiazolo[3,4-g]quinoxaline-4,9-diamine.
